# Break-Glass: Catalog Cache Invalidation

Scope: the Pinrow product catalog at Veldstone Retail. If stale prices persist after a purge and the Hollowmere invalidation queue is wedged, use break-glass to flush the edge tier directly. Contractors: get verbal sign-off from the catalog lead first. Steps: open the Hollowmere admin shell, select emergency-flush, confirm the tenant, and run it once — repeated flushes thrash the origin. Access is logged and expires after 20 minutes. Unseal the admin shell with the passphrase below.

recovery phrase for kahop-tajog: istix-casvan

Ticket: OrphanSweep is deleting snapshot volumes that still have pending restore jobs in Bramblehook's queue. Root cause looks like the sweeper's grace window reading minutes as seconds after the Larkspur refactor. Impact so far: three test-tier volumes, no customer data. Mitigation in place: sweeper paused on the Vellmont cluster until the unit conversion fix lands. For the weekly sync, the fix is in review and a canary run is scheduled. Reference trace for the canary run follows below.

session token of tajef-bageg = htk21_5d90d574934f3ccae6437

## Restarting the Bellgrove Timetable Solver

If the solver wedges mid-run (usually a constraint loop), stop the worker, clear `/tmp/bellgrove-partials`, and restart. Don't touch the teacher-availability cache — it rebuilds itself. Check SOLVER_MAX_ITERATIONS is still 20000; lower values cause half-baked timetables. The worker also needs to auth against the roster service, and that secret goes on the next line.

env line for fafof-fahag: LEDGER_TOKEN5=f8790

TICKET #—Missed pick-up: replacement server for Fenwick branch

Summary: The scheduled collection of the replacement Corvane R2 server from our Hartleigh depot did not occur yesterday; the courier arrived after the dock had closed. The unit remains sealed in its original crate with the asset label intact. A new collection is booked for tomorrow morning, and the receiving site should expect delivery by mid-afternoon. Please inspect the crate seal on arrival before signing. The confidential courier hand-over instruction is recorded below.

dispatch memo: the quenax olidor courier leaves the lamvan aldath keliel ledger at gate 2085 under passcode 005795